After receiving his Bachelors Degree from the University of Missouri, Dr. George Lucas served in the field sales positions with American Hospital Supply Corporation and Pitney Bowes. He then returned to MU to complete his MBA, and his Ph.D. He first served on the graduate faculty of Texas A&M University. Here he had the opportunity to be a founding member of the now internationally recognized Center for Retailing Studies. In 1987, he joined the graduate faculty of the University of Memphis, where he taught and conducted research for over a decade. He is highly regarded as a speaker, trainer and expert in marketing strategy, negotiations, retailing, personal selling, and international marketing. George is frequently quoted in magazines, newspapers, and trade publications, is on the Editorial Review Board of the Journal of Personal Selling and Sales Management and is featured on a popular nationally televised program on personal selling.
Lucas is the author of several leading business books, including, Retailing, Marketing Strategy and Plans, Marketing Strategy Text and Cases, and Marketing Strategy. In his training and consulting activities, he has impacted literally thousands of salespeople, buyers, marketing managers, and top executives, representing hundreds of firms, including Sedgwick, Royal/Sun Alliance Insurance, ITT Hartford, FedEx, Armor All/Clorox, National Commerce Bank Services, Procter and Gamble, International Paper, Green Tree Div. of Conseco and SouthTrust..
